Overview

Bel Jou Hotel eptiomizes the quintessential Caribbean experience, tucked away on a verdant mountain in the midst of a tropical utopia. The vantage point from its location provides an outstanding view of Castries and the sparkling Caribbean Sea with the island of Martinique glimmering in the distance. This adults-only scenic oasis offers the warmest of welcomes and the dedication of the long-term staff offering the best in St. Lucian hospitality.

Wonderful Place With Wonderful Staff

newspapertaxi (Nottingham, United Kingdom) on Mar 27, 2025

We couldn't have asked for more from our 12 nights at the Bel Jou! Virtually everything is covered in previous reviews so I'll just add some bits n bobs. Yes towels are on sun beds very early, in some case...s before the sun comes up, but there always seemed to be free beds somewhere to use. Better than this though is to book the free shuttle to the beautiful beach where there are free beds and shade a plenty. We took the 9am shuttle there and the 1pm shuttle back which was perfect. At breakfast and dinner check out the "local corner" where, as the name suggests, there were a couple of local dishes on offer. Maybe not the breakfast offering so much but the dinner offerings were suberb. You can book any excursions you want to do at the hotel which is preferable than booking beforehand as you'll have an idea of what the weather will be like by this time. We found that of the 3 we booked 2 were the same price as booking independantly beforehand and 1 was actually cheaper. If your footie team is playing and you can't bear to miss it ask them to put it on in the rooftop bar - they have a firestick. There was the odd thing that could be improved upon but in no way spoiled our stay. Our room could have done with a bit of TLC, decorating and furniture were beginning to show their age and no USB ports which seem standard now in most hotels. Food was often just luke warm though the day before we left they had brand new food pots/dishes installed so this may have resolved that. Breakfast was from 7am but everything was not available at this time - the pancakes and french toast often didn't appear until after 7.30am by which time I'd finished. Finally, as most reviews have mentioned, it's the staff that make this place so special. Everyone, be they front facing, kitchen, maintenance, gardening etc always had a good morning or hello with a smile on their face. There are far too many to mention but a special thanks to Vakessa for keeping our beer and wine flowing in the evening and the lovely (despite being a Gooner) Quincy who always had time for a chat. Don't hesitate - book it.
